Update of bug #34318 (project weechat):
Status: None => Ready For Test
Assigned to: flashcode => nils_2
_______________________________________________________
Follow-up Comment #4:
patch for a case insensitive buffer_search. To enable a case insensitive
search, you have to use prefix "(?i)" in front of "name" argument.
Example (python):
weechat.prnt("",'ptr_buffer: %s' %
weechat.buffer_search('irc','(?i)freenode.#photography'))
This patch also includes a new API function called
"weechat_buffer_search_by_full_name"
Prototype:
struct t_gui_buffer *weechat_buffer_search_by_full_name (const char
*full_name);
Arguments:
full_name: full name of buffer ("plugin.name")
Allowed prefix:
(?i) : for case insensitive search
Return value:
pointer to buffer found, NULL if not found
C example:
struct t_gui_buffer *my_buffer = weechat_buffer_search_by_full_name
("my_buffer");
Script (Python):
# prototype
buffer = weechat.buffer_search_by_full_name(full_name)
# example
buffer = weechat.buffer_search_by_full_name("irc.freenode.#weechat")
buffer = weechat.buffer_search_by_full_name("(?i)irc.freenode.#WeEcHaT")
(file #27739)
_______________________________________________________
Additional Item Attachment:
File name: buffer_search_case_insensitive.patch Size:11 KB
_______________________________________________________
Reply to this item at:
<http://savannah.nongnu.org/bugs/?34318>
_______________________________________________
Nachricht gesendet von/durch Savannah
http://savannah.nongnu.org/
_______________________________________________
Weechat-dev mailing list
[email protected]
https://lists.nongnu.org/mailman/listinfo/weechat-dev